cirrus: fix blit region check



Issues:
 * Doesn't check pitches correctly in case it is negative.
 * Doesn't check width at all.

Turn macro into functions while being at it, also factor out the check
for one region which we then can simply call twice for src + dst.

This is CVE-2014-8106.

static bool blit_region_is_unsafe(struct CirrusVGAState *s,
                                  int32_t pitch, int32_t addr)
{
    if (pitch < 0) {
        int64_t min = addr
            + ((int64_t)s->cirrus_blt_height-1) * pitch;
        int32_t max = addr
            + s->cirrus_blt_width;
        if (min < 0 || max >= s->vga.vram_size) {
            return true;
        }
    } else {
        int64_t max = addr
            + ((int64_t)s->cirrus_blt_height-1) * pitch
            + s->cirrus_blt_width;
        if (max >= s->vga.vram_size) {
            return true;
        }
    }
    return false;
}

static bool blit_is_unsafe(struct CirrusVGAState *s)
{
    /* should be the case, see cirrus_bitblt_start */
    assert(s->cirrus_blt_width > 0);
    assert(s->cirrus_blt_height > 0);

    if (blit_region_is_unsafe(s, s->cirrus_blt_dstpitch,
                              s->cirrus_blt_dstaddr & s->cirrus_addr_mask)) {
        return true;
    }
    if (blit_region_is_unsafe(s, s->cirrus_blt_srcpitch,
                              s->cirrus_blt_srcaddr & s->cirrus_addr_mask)) {
        return true;
    }

    return false;
}
